Connecting Rod Bearing INFOID:0000000012197314 WHEN NEW CONNECTING ROD AND CRANKSHAFT ARE USED 1. Apply connecting rod big end diameter grade stamped on con- necting rod side face to the row in the “Connecting Rod Bearing Selection Table”. 2. Apply crankshaft pin journal diameter grade stamped on crank- shaft front side to the column in the “Connecting Rod Bearing Selection Table”. 3. Read the symbol at the cross point of selected row and column in the “Connecting Rod Bearing Selection Table”. 4. Apply the symbol obtained to the “Connecting Rod Bearing Grade Table” to select connecting rod bearing. WHEN CONNECTING ROD AND CRANKSHAFT ARE REUSED 1. Measure the dimensions of the connecting rod big end diameter and crankshaft pin journal diameter indi- vidually.
